The global Animal Intestinal Health Market is projected to grow from $4.5 billion in 2025 to $9.1 billion by 2035, at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.3%. The animal intestinal health market is driven by the growing focus on livestock productivity, disease prevention, and feed efficiency. According to the U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A) National Agricultural Statistics Service, the United States had 86.7 million head of cattle and calves as of January 1, 2025, highlighting the substantial livestock population requiring nutritional and gut health management solutions. Increasing adoption of probiotics, prebiotics, enzymes, and phytogenic feed additives is further supporting market growth.
The Type segment of the Animal Intestinal Health Market includes probiotics, prebiotics, phytogenics, enzymes, organic acids, minerals, vitamins, amino acids, and others. Among these, probiotics and prebiotics represent key segments due to their growing adoption in improving gut microbiota balance, enhancing nutrient utilization, and supporting animal immunity. Probiotics help maintain intestinal microbial health and reduce dependence on antibiotics, while prebiotics promote beneficial bacterial growth in the digestive system. Enzymes and organic acids are also gaining importance due to their role in improving feed efficiency, digestion, and pathogen control. Increasing demand for sustainable animal nutrition solutions and antibiotic-free feed additives is driving innovation across intestinal health products.

The Application segment of the Animal Intestinal Health Market includes poultry, swine, ruminants, aquaculture, companion animals, and others. Poultry represents a major application segment due to the extensive use of intestinal health solutions to improve feed conversion, growth performance, and disease resistance in commercial poultry production. Swine applications are expanding with increasing adoption of probiotics, enzymes, and organic acids to enhance digestive health and productivity. Ruminants benefit from nutritional supplements that improve rumen function and nutrient absorption, while aquaculture is witnessing growth due to rising demand for healthy fish and sustainable farming practices. Companion animal applications are also increasing with growing focus on pet nutrition and preventive healthcare.

Increasing Adoption of Probiotics and Microbiome-Based Solutions for Animal Health:
The Animal Intestinal Health Market is witnessing a strong trend toward the adoption of probiotics, prebiotics, postbiotics, and microbiome-based feed solutions to improve digestive health and animal performance. Livestock producers are increasingly shifting toward natural feed additives as alternatives to antibiotic growth promoters due to rising concerns regarding antimicrobial resistance and regulatory restrictions. Advances in microbiome research are enabling the development of targeted solutions that enhance gut microbial balance, nutrient absorption, immunity, and overall animal productivity. Additionally, growing investments in precision nutrition and functional feed ingredients are supporting the development of innovative intestinal health products for poultry, swine, and ruminants.
Rising Demand for Sustainable Livestock Production and Improved Animal Productivity:
The increasing global demand for animal protein and the need for efficient livestock production are major drivers of the Animal Intestinal Health Market. Farmers and producers are adopting advanced intestinal health solutions to improve feed conversion efficiency, reduce disease risks, and enhance growth performance while maintaining animal welfare standards. The growing prevalence of gastrointestinal disorders in livestock, combined with increasing awareness of preventive animal healthcare, is boosting demand for gut health products. Furthermore, government initiatives promoting sustainable agriculture, restrictions on antibiotic usage, and rising investments in animal nutrition research are encouraging the adoption of probiotics, enzymes, and other functional feed additives worldwide.
